Here's how I break down the decision for our projects. It depends entirely on three things: the volume of units, the installation environment, and the security requirements.
Scenario A: The High-Volume New Construction Project (50+ Units)
If you're outfitting a new apartment complex or a row of townhomes, your priorities are different than someone doing a single custom home. You need consistency, ease of programming, and a supply chain that won't let you down mid-project.
My Recommendation
Go with a brand-specific, multi-code remote system. Think LiftMaster, Chamberlain, or Genie. These brands typically offer a universal remote line that works across their opener models. For new construction, you're likely installing their openers anyway, so sticking with the same brand for the remote eliminates compatibility headaches.
But here's the kicker—most buyers focus on the per-unit pricing of the remote, which can be as low as $15–20 for a basic model from a generic brand. The question everyone asks is "What's your best price on 60 remotes?" The question they should ask is "How many hours will it take your team to program and test all 60 units?"
Cost controller insight (based on Q3 2024 data): We compared a quote for a LiftMaster universal remote at $22/unit vs. a generic compatible remote at $14/unit. The generics required manual programming for each unit (30 min/unit), while the LiftMaster used a multi-code cloning system (5 min/unit). Labor cost difference: $3,000 in programming time for generics vs. $500 for the branded option. Net savings with the "expensive" remote: $2,500.
Key factors:
- Programming speed: Multi-code systems that can be cloned from one master remote save hours on site. For 50+ units, this is non-negotiable.
- Durability: Remotes that come pre-programmed from the factory (like some LiftMaster models) avoid the issue of field programming errors.
- Warranty: Brand-name remotes often carry a 1-year warranty. Generics? You're lucky to get 90 days.
- Supply chain: We once ordered 60 generics from a distributor who ran out of stock mid-order. The delay cost us $800 in rescheduling fees. Brand-name distributors tend to have better stock reliability—or at least they're more transparent about lead times.
Scenario B: The Retrofit / Renovation Project (1–10 Units)
This is where most of my personal experience lies. We handle a lot of retrofit work for older commercial buildings and multi-tenant retail spaces. The owners want modern security features but don't want to re-wire the entire opener mechanism.
My Recommendation
Invest in a universal remote with rolling code technology. If the existing opener is from a major brand (and it's not ancient), a universal remote like a Genie Universal or a Chamberlain Clicker will often work. But double-check the compatibility list. The assumption is that "universal" means it works with everything. The reality is most universals work with ~90% of openers from the last 15 years—and the other 10% can be a nightmare.
The thing everyone misses? Rolling code security matters for legal liability. In 2023, we had an incident where a fixed-code remote was used for a commercial garage. Someone figured out the code (it was a 4-digit dip switch, which is trivially easy to brute-force) and gained access to the storage area. The tenant sued the property owner. That "free" remote with the old opener? Cost the owner about $4,200 in legal fees and a $1,200 redo to upgrade the whole system.
If I could redo that decision, I'd have insisted on a rolling-code upgrade from day one. But given what we knew then—the owner was trying to save money on a single remote—the choice seemed reasonable. Hindsight is 20/20.
Key factors:
- Security standard: Rolling code (e.g., Security+ 2.0 from LiftMaster) is now the minimum acceptable standard per most commercial property insurance policies. Verify this, I'd have to check the specific policy language, but it's been a recurring point in our audits.
- Compatibility with old openers: If the opener is pre-2000, you might need a special adapter or a whole new opener. We've seen this with buildings from the 1980s. The cheap remote simply won't work.
- User-friendliness: For multi-tenant buildings, the remote needs to be easy for a non-technical property manager to reprogram when a tenant leaves. A remote with a visible "learn" button is better than one that requires a dip-switch diagram.
Scenario C: The High-Security / Custom Installation
This is the niche case: a single garage for a luxury home, a high-end commercial showroom, or a facility with sensitive equipment. The owner wants the best possible security and features, and cost is secondary.
My Recommendation
Go with a smart remote system that integrates with a larger security ecosystem. Think myQ from LiftMaster or a Chamberlain model with built-in Wi-Fi. These allow for remote monitoring, one-time guest access codes, and integration with home security systems (like Ring or Alarm.com). The remote itself becomes just one access point in a broader system.
Now, here's where I have to be honest: for a single installation, a $60–80 smart remote (or opener with a built-in system) is overkill if all they need is to open the door from the car. The numbers said go with a $25 universal remote. My gut said this client values peace of mind and future-proofing more than immediate savings. I went with my gut. Turns out the client was thrilled with the ability to grant temporary access to a contractor while they were on vacation.
Key factors:
- Integration: Does it work with the client's existing smart home platform (Google Home, Amazon Alexa, Apple HomeKit)? Not all remotes do.
- App-based control: The remote itself is almost a secondary concern. The primary interface is the smartphone app.
- Security: These systems use end-to-end encryption. The industry standard for smart garage door openers is rolling code + encrypted signal.
- Battery backup: For high-security applications, a remote that works without power (e.g., via a hardwired switch) is a plus.
How to Figure Out Which Scenario You're In
It's not always obvious. Here's a quick checklist I use before recommending anything:
- How many units are we talking about? More than 10? Go with Scenario A. Less than 5? Go with Scenario B or C, depending on the client's budget for security.
- What's the existing infrastructure? If the opener is already installed and is a major brand (LiftMaster, Chamberlain, Genie), Scenario B is your likely path. If it's an off-brand or ancient, you may be forced into an upgrade (Scenario A).
- What's the security requirement? For most residential and standard commercial, Scenario B's rolling code is sufficient. For luxury or sensitive installations, Scenario C's encryption and integration are worth the premium.
- What's the labor cost? This is the most overlooked factor. We calculated that for a 5-unit project, the labor to program a generic remote was about $300, while a multi-code system was $100. That $200 difference often buys the branded remote and then some. The assumption is that remotes are a small-cost item. The reality is their installation is a large time sink.
To be fair, there are always exceptions. I had a project where the owner insisted on using an old, fixed-code remote for a small storage garage. The opener was from 1995, and a universal remote wouldn't work without a $200 adapter. The owner decided to replace the entire opener for $450. That's a case where Scenario B led to an opener upgrade, which pushed them into Scenario A territory. Always verify the existing hardware before making a recommendation.
A final thought on vendor relationships: our procurement policy now requires quotes from at least 2 vendors for any remote order over $500. I once had a supplier try to sell me "proprietary" remotes that only worked with their openers. They quoted me $30/unit. The actual cost from the manufacturer's direct channel was $18. That's a 66% markup hidden in a claim of "expert support." Always check the manufacturer's published list.
